The exploration of George Eliot's unique perspective on Judaism reveals the complexities of her identity as a Victorian woman and a non-Jewish author. The book delves into her motivations for championing Jewish themes, particularly the aspirations for nationhood and statehood, highlighting her significant contribution to English literature and her empathy towards a marginalized community. It examines the intersection of her beliefs and literary endeavors, offering insights into her remarkable legacy.
